forcedotcom/aura

Aura doesn't build locally.

Closed this issue · 1 comments

Hi all,

I've just pulled the latest code and unfortunately getting the error below when I run the following command:

mvn -e -DskipUnitTests clean install

(DskipUnitTests as there is a separate issue with unit tests...). Am I doing something wrong?

[INFO] 34 errors
[INFO] -------------------------------------------------------------
[INFO] ------------------------------------------------------------------------
[INFO] Reactor Summary for Aura Framework 0.6000-SNAPSHOT:
[INFO]
[INFO] Aura Framework ..................................... SUCCESS [  6.859 s]
[INFO] aura-interfaces .................................... SUCCESS [  2.571 s]
[INFO] aura-spring ........................................ SUCCESS [  0.802 s]
[INFO] aura-util .......................................... SUCCESS [  5.733 s]
[INFO] aura ............................................... FAILURE [  5.416 s]
[INFO] aura-impl-expression ............................... SKIPPED
[INFO] aura-impl .......................................... SKIPPED
[INFO] aura-tools ......................................... SKIPPED
[INFO] aura-components .................................... SKIPPED
[INFO] aura-modules ....................................... SKIPPED
[INFO] aura-resources ..................................... SKIPPED
[INFO] aura-integration-test .............................. SKIPPED
[INFO] aura-jetty ......................................... SKIPPED
[INFO] archetype for Aura-based "hello, world" ............ SKIPPED
[INFO] ------------------------------------------------------------------------
[INFO] BUILD FAILURE
[INFO] ------------------------------------------------------------------------
[INFO] Total time:  21.814 s
[INFO] Finished at: 2018-12-18T12:53:15Z
[INFO] ------------------------------------------------------------------------
[ERROR]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.8.0:compile (default-compile) on project aura: Compilation failure: Compilation failure:
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[22,755]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[23,784]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[31,1096] BundleType c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[32,1212] BundleType c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[33,1366] BundleType c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\service\ModulesCompilerService.java:[33,1432] OutputConfig c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[26,1032]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[27,1070]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[28,1106]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[69,2217] Reference c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[75,2347] Reference c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[119,3645] TemplateModuleDependencies c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\def\module\ModuleDef.java:[153,4879] ModuleExport c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[19,711]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[20,742]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[21,782] The import org.lwc cannot be resolved
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[35,1158]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[36,1210]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[37,1259]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[39,1356] CompilerReport c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[45,1553]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[46,1600]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[47,1644]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[56,2011]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[57,2058]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[58,2102]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[60,2189] CompilerReport c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[64,2334]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[65,2384]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[66,2428] ClassMember c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[68,2516] CompilerReport c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[77,2891] DecoratorParameterValue c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[84,3129] DecoratorParameterValue cannot be resolved to a type
[ERROR] C:\Users\piotr_justyna\Documents\aura\aura\src\main\java\org\auraframework\modules\ModulesCompilerData.java:[89,3312] DecoratorParameterValue cannot be resolved to a type
[ERROR] -> [Help 1]
org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.8.0:compile (default-compile) on project aura: Compilation failure
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:215)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:156)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:148)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:117)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:81)
    at org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build (SingleThreadedBuilder.java:56)
    at org.apache.maven.lifecycle.internal.LifecycleStarter.execute (LifecycleStarter.java:128)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192)
    at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105)
    at org.apache.maven.cli.MavenCli.execute (MavenCli.java:956)
    at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:288)
    at org.apache.maven.cli.MavenCli.main (MavenCli.java:192)
    at sun.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:498)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ced (Launcher.java:289)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ch (Launcher.java:229)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ode (Launcher.java:415)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main (Launcher.java:356)
Caused by: org.apache.maven.plugin.compiler.CompilationFailureException: Compilation failure
    at org.apache.maven.plugin.compiler.AbstractCompilerMojo.execute (AbstractCompilerMojo.java:1215)
    at org.apache.maven.plugin.compiler.CompilerMojo.execute (CompilerMojo.java:188)
    at org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o (DefaultBuildPluginManager.java:137)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:210)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:156)
    at org.apache.maven.lifecycle.internal.MojoExecutor.execute (MojoExecutor.java:148)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:117)
    at org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ject (LifecycleModuleBuilder.java:81)
    at org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build (SingleThreadedBuilder.java:56)
    at org.apache.maven.lifecycle.internal.LifecycleStarter.execute (LifecycleStarter.java:128)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:305)
    at org.apache.maven.DefaultMaven.doExecute (DefaultMaven.java:192)
    at org.apache.maven.DefaultMaven.execute (DefaultMaven.java:105)
    at org.apache.maven.cli.MavenCli.execute (MavenCli.java:956)
    at org.apache.maven.cli.MavenCli.doMain (MavenCli.java:288)
    at org.apache.maven.cli.MavenCli.main (MavenCli.java:192)
    at sun.reflect.NativeMethodAccessorImpl.invoke0 (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ke (N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ke (D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ke (Method.java:498)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ced (Launcher.java:289)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ch (Launcher.java:229)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ode (Launcher.java:415)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main (Launcher.java:356)
[ERROR]
[ERROR] Re-run Maven using the -X switch to enable full debug logging.
[ERROR]
[ERROR] For more information about the errors and possible solutions, please read the following articles:
[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/MojoFailureException
[ERROR]
[ERROR] After correcting the problems, you can resume the build with the command
[ERROR]   mvn <goals> -rf :aura

This probably has something to do with my OS (windows) as the code works with docker, linux containers (albeit with no tests, see #177). My docker setup:

dockerfile:

FROM maven:3.6.0-jdk-10-slim
RUN mkdir --parents /usr/src/app
ADD aura /usr/src/app
WORKDIR /usr/src/app
RUN mvn -DskipUnitTests clean install

image command:

docker build -t my-aura:0.1 .